A structured approach to basic programming download books

This lesson will clear the concepts of c programming and make programming easy as. An introduction to the theory of numbers leo moser pdf. Structured programming is a programming paradigm aimed at improving the clarity, quality, and development time of a computer program by making extensive use of the structured control flow constructs of selection ifthenelse and repetition while and for, block structures, and subroutines in contrast to using. If you are keen to learn and construct your own compiler, this is the right book to get started. A structured programming approach using c 3rd edition 97805344921. Basics of compiler design is written as introductory compiler course for computer science engineering students. Download visual basic programming by examples pdf ebook. Introduction to programming basic, a structured approach chris r siragusa on.

Pdf structured programming sp is a technique devised to improve the reliability and clarity of programs. Top 5 best computer programming books for beginners web. Based on the tenet that good habits are formed early, authors behrouz forouzan and richard gilberg consistently emphasize the principles of structured programming and software engineering. The online resources for students include wide range of textbooklinked resources for practice. The first section represents an initial outstanding contribution to the understanding of the design of programs and the use of structured programming. Structured programming kenneth leroy busbee and dave braunschweig. Structured programming sp is a technique devised to improve the reliability and clarity. Top 5 best computer programming books for beginners web and. Animated algorithm and data structure visualization resource. He proposed a go to less method of planning programming logic that eliminated the need for the branching category of control structures. An object oriented approach to programming logic and design. Programming fundamentals a modular structured approach using. It covers the four components of software design, namely, architectural design, detail design, data design and interface design. It is away of conceptualizing what it means to perform computation and how tasks to be carried out on the computer should be structured and organized.

Pdf an introduction to structured programming researchgate. As you all are aware that c is the basic programming language that will enhance and build your capability before learning and. It covers the basics of programming but its not a perfect fit for a oneterm only. As programs are analyzed, styles and standards are further explained. It has all the information from the basics that will help a beginner to start working with c programming language. Computer science a structured programming approach using c by behrouz. Although it was written a long time ago 1978, its still a bestseller around the world. Sep 14, 2017 top 5 best computer programming books for beginners 14 september 2017 walter b. The other two havent fared as well, in part because the ideas in them have become incorporated into mainstream languages and platforms, so theyre extremely familiar. Click download or read online button to get programming in c a practical approach book now. From the beginning, true basic was a fully structured language. Structured design is a systematic methodology to determine design specification of software.

Structured approach to software development programming. Download an object oriented approach to programming logic and design or read online books in pdf, epub, tuebl, and mobi format. Bbc basic for windows is an ideal first programming language to learn and is emminantly suitable for teaching programming to both children and adults. Jan 19, 2018 this ezed video gives an introduction to structured programming top down analysis modular programming structured code. It is machineindependent, structured programming language which is used extensively in various applications.

After reading this chapter, you will learn the basic concepts of structured programming, modularity, and information hiding and study the use of the following keywords. Db708fcomputer science a structured programming approach. In order for a system to function properly as intended, the system. Together, the two books provide the perfect opportunity to learn the fundamentals of programming while gaining exposure to an actual programming language. This book provides information on programming with c. What visual basic is not h visual basic is not, a powerful programming language that enables you to do anything you want. This book book will introduce the reader to the theory and practice of answer set programming asp.

See answer to why is oop objectoriented programming the standard paradigm for most software. Click download or read online button to get fundamentals of programming using java book now. Home software development java language java programming, 9th edition. In sp, control of program flow is restricted to three structures, sequence, else, and do. This ezed video gives an introduction to structured programming top down analysis modular programming structured code.

Structured programming is a programming paradigm aimed at improving the clarity, quality, and development time of a computer program by making extensive use of the structured control flow constructs of selection ifthenelse and repetition while and for, block structures, and subroutines it emerged in the late 1950s with the appearance of the algol 58 and algol 60 programming. C is a generalpurpose programming language that is extremely popular, simple, and flexible. Swordfish is a true compiler that generates optimised, stand alone code which can be programmed directly into your microcontroller. Fundamentals of programming using java download ebook pdf. This book, in the words of the authors, teaches students first how to write good functions, and then how to implement them in classes. Download db708fcomputer science a structured programming approach. Structured programming this book, in the words of the authors, teaches students first how to write good functions, and then how to implement them in classes. The visual basic pal is designed to be paired with the sixth edition of joyce farrells programming logic and design text. Read the book online, print the pdf, or buy a copy of the book.

Programming fundamentals a modular structured approach. Swordfish is a highly structured, modular pic basic compiler for the pic18 family of pic microcontrollers. Pdf schaum s outline of theory and problems of programming. The approach of this course will be to take the student through a progression of materials that will allow the student to develop the skills of programming. Considered as one of the three best programming books of all the time, the c programming language helps you to learn how to start basic computer programming. This book is the classic text in the art of computer programming. Which is the best book to learn the concepts of object. Programming in c a practical approach download ebook pdf. An object oriented approach to programming logic and.

Read online db708fcomputer science a structured programming approach. This book teaches you fundamentals of compilers and how to construct a compiler for simple programming language. In my tutorial i used vb 6 to elucidate stepbystep the best way to create a straightforward visual basic software program and relatively difficult one a affected individual administration system that is using database. Structured programming is a programming paradigm aimed at improving the clarity, quality, and development time of a computer program by making extensive use of the structured control flow constructs of selection ifthenelse and repetition while and for, block structures, and subroutines. In addition to this text, he has also coauthored several others including computer science. All books are in clear copy here, and all files are secure so dont worry about it.

Discover the power of java for developing applications today when you trust the engaging, handson approach in farrells java programming, 9e. A structured programming approach using c continues to present both computer science theory and clanguage syntax with a principlebeforeimplementation approach. Click download or read online button to get an object oriented approach to programming logic and design book now. The second part describes how similar principles can be applied in the design of data structures. A structured approach isbndb books and publications. Else, and do while, or to a structure derivable from a combination of the basic three. Structured basic programming 1987 was written by john kemeny and thomas kurtz as a textbook for an introductory course in basic. Youll need your oxford id login details to access these free resources. Structured programming is a programming paradigm aimed at improving the clarity, quality, and development time of a computer program by making extensive use of the structured control flow constructs of. The basic principles, tools and techniques of structured methodology are discussed in this chapter. The concept of structured programming started in the late 1960s with an article by edsger dijkstra. What had been dartmouth basic 7 became the first version of true basic. These textbooks are typically available in the used textbook market at a reasonable price. It is assumed that students either will be in possession of or will have access to a true basic reference manual, true basic being the version of basic used in this book.

Whenever possible, the authors develop the principle of a subject before they introduce. The final section provides a synthesis of the previous two and expounds the close. This site is like a library, use search box in the widget to get ebook that you want. Feb 01, 2005 the third edition of computer science. One book is an introduction to programming, teaching you basic concepts of organizing data and. Designed for students with no prior programming experience, the book explains each basic principle of programming first in general, languageindependent terms, and then discusses how the. Numerous solved problems and examples demonstrate and reinforce ideas discussed in each chapter.

A programming paradigm, or programming model, is an approach to programming a computer based on a mathematical theory or acoherent set of principles. Introduction to programming basic, a structured approach. Pdf computer science a structured programming approach. Here is an uncategorized list of online programming books available for free download. Structured approach to basic programming book pdf download. Forouzan and gilberg employ a clear organizational structure, supplemented by.

It contains eight chapters, one for each lecture of the course. Selection ifthenelse repetition while and for block structures. Following is a curated list of top c programming books that should be part of any c developers library. Structure and interpretation of computer programs, 2nd edition. Mar 23, 2020 c is a generalpurpose programming language that is extremely popular, simple, and flexible. Get your kindle here, or download a free kindle reading app. Programming fundamentalsorientation and syllabus wikibooks. In this lesson, hrishikesh damania has explained about structured programming approachspa. Forouzan and gilberg employ a clear organizational structure, supplemented by easy to follow figures, charts, and tables. Swordfishse includes everything you get with the commercial version, including the full list of supported microcontrollers. Kenneth leroy bubsee writes the learning modules of this textbook is written without considering any specific language. Programming fundamentalsstructured programming wikibooks. Forouzan and gilberg employ a clear organizational structure, supplemented by easytofollow figures, charts, and tables.

603 1621 1407 448 52 153 1435 1113 945 1425 694 1460 1024 1026 352 765 267 1131 795 335 50 1238 1130 1313 506 397 875 787 1610 474 1064 1419 137 808 551 404 1410 1297 1091 975 1065 1061 335 1386 854 635 585 887 239 500